Read on to discover the four modes of persuasion and how you can use them to make your writing more effective. Aristotle introduced the modes of persuasion in his book Rhetoric.
The first three modes he identified as ethospathos persuasive speeches on racism, and logos. The first kind depends on the personal character of the speaker; the second on putting the audience into a certain frame of mind; the third on the proof, or apparent proof, provided persuasive speeches on racism the words of the speech itself. The A persuasive thesis usually contains an opinion and the reason why your opinion is true. Example: Peanut butter and jelly sandwiches are the best type of sandwich because they are versatile, easy to make, and taste good. In this persuasive thesis statement, you see that I state my opinion (the best type of sandwich), which means I have chosen a
